Jackie Savi-Cannon is a leading professional speaker in the area of corporate wellness.  She has a diverse background, which includes an honors degree in Communication Studies, bachelor of Education and certifications in group exercise and personal training. She is also a yoga exercise specialist and has played an active role in the fitness industry for over 16 years as an instructor/trainer, fitness competitor as well as health club owner.  Her most recent achievement is surviving breast cancer.  At 38 years old, her journey began with surgery, aggressive chemotherapy and radiation.  As an educator who has always combined theory with life experience, Jackie uses her journey with cancer as a driving force to illustrate the endless possibilities we have to proactively enhance our life experience. www.jsclifestyle.com

Dr. Natasha is a board certified Naturopathic Doctor and a member of the OAND and CAND. After receiving her Bachelor of Biological Science from the University of Windsor, she completed her 4 year Doctor of Naturopathic Medicine diploma from the Canadian College of Naturopathic Medicine.  She has been in practice for 4 years, teaches classes on healthy cooking and has developed and will be instructing continuing education health courses for St. Clair College.
